Kerala Finance Minister K M Mani, who was invited as a special guest, said there was nothing wrong in the ruling and opposition parties cooperating for the larger interests of the state.
Mani, whose Kerala Congress (M) is a key partner in the ruling Congress-led UDF, said his presence at a seminar of CPI(M) should not be construed as signal that he was mulling to cross over to the LDF.
"The opposition is the fifth estate in a democracy. Cooperation of the ruling and opposition parties over common issues concerning the people is necessary. But this should not be interpreted that we are planning switch over to the other camp," the Kerala Congress veteran said.
Significantly, Mani's acceptance of CPI(M)'s invitation has fuelled speculation that it signalled a realignment in the state which could even lead to the fall of the Oommen Chandy government.
